Download logoFor refugees, COVID-19 has become an economic crisis on top of a public health crisis
In a race against time, UNHCR is supporting refugees and IDPs to protect themselves against COVID-19 infections.
The Agency also tries, with limited funding, to buffer the pandemic’s disastrous impact on their family economies.
